每天学点Java知识 ------> 方法
上一篇 /
下一篇 2014-07-17 09:42:31
/ 个人分类:Java学习
方法在很多地方被称为函数,是一段可以被重复调用的代码
方法的基本定义格式:
public static 返回值类型 方法名称(参数列表){
return 返回值;
}
例1:定义一个有参有返回值的方法
public class TestDemo{
public static void main(String args[]){
if(isType(3)){ //isType()返回boolean型数据,直接判断
System.out.println("偶数");
}else{
System.out.println("奇数");
}
}
public static boolean isType(int num){ //true表示是偶数,false表示为奇数
return num % 2 == 0; //是否可以被2整除
}
}
在定义方法的时候,如果一个方法使用了void声明,理论上此方法不能够返回数据,但是可以通过return结束调用(即return之后的程序不再执行)
例2:使用return结束方法调用
public class TestDemo{
public static void main(String args[]){
fun(10); //调用方法
fun(30); //调用方法
}
public static void fun(int num){
if(num == 10){
return; //结束方法调用
}
System.out.println("数值: " + num);
}
}
程序运行结果:
数值:30
这一结束的操作和循环控制的break与continue是一样的,唯一不同的是,此种方式只能用在方法定义上,而且必须保证方法的返回值类型为void,不过这3种操作都离不开if语句判断的支持
收藏
举报
TAG: